Kenji Ardito is a history of art student living in Florence, Italy. His somewhat lonely and melancholic routine suddenly comes to a halt during a metal detecting trip, when Kenji hears the voice of a soldier who died in World War II, leading him to find his buried remains. Then, other similar things happen, leaving him frightened and confused. On a train to Tokyo, he meets Daphne and falls deeply, passionately in love with her. The adventures of Kenji, Daphne and their friends interlace with murders, kidnappings and the themes of art, beauty, and the search for physical and spiritual balance in everyday life, with glimpses of enchanting gardens and hidden retreats in splendid Florence, far from the usual tourist clich?s. Mark Verner lives in Italy and is currently working at the second novel of Kenji and Daphne's adventures.
